Transaction 7eb96e1d070d2f44a151dbeb8574498857243fbbee56e698481dab8cd4839e6b

4 Input
1 Outputs
  • 7eb96e1d070d2f44a151dbeb8574498857243fbbee56e698481dab8cd4839e6b:0
  • value  16951256
    address  1Em7cq5PKniKRaRtKHvmVKgnAm2xVEux2w